1. Here’s How to Do Some Efficient Ore Mining

The most basic skill that every player wants to learn how to be good at Minecraft is mining. Being able to spelunk a cave and strip mine as many resources as possible can save you time. If you can make your mining more efficient, whether in PC or even augmented reality, it will give you more time to explore and craft.

Here’s a pro tip on how to get good at Minecraft mining. Prepare many copies of your pick, your sword, some food, stacks of wood and stone. If you have some torches, bring half a stack at least.

Mine from the surface down to layers 5 – 12 using 2-wide staircase mining. Once you reach somewhere between these layers, start mining horizontal in one direction. Once you make a nice lengthy tunnel, branch mine on the sides of the tunnel, making different sub-tunnels.

Why?

Many Minecraft experts strip mine to get as much ore as possible. At this layer, diamonds start showing up more often. You can also mine other valuable ores like Lapis Lazuli, Gold, Redstone, and Iron. More diamonds mean better equipment for the latter stages of the game.

2. Build Experience Using Bookshelves

Among Minecraft pro tips, this is one that most people overlook. If you want to have a chance at fighting bosses like the Ender Dragon or the Wither, you need enchantments. Build yourself an enchanting table fast, together with a sufficient library for a 30-level equipment upgrade.

To do so, you need to craft an enchanting table first from a book, two diamonds, and four obsidian. Prop this in your home base and start stacking bookshelves around it. Here’s what makes it interesting.

You need 15 bookshelves to get an enchantment level of 30. If you want to learn how to be good at Minecraft, building bookshelves are crucial. Bookshelves are resource intensive, needing:

  • 6 planks
  • 27 sugar cane for 9 papers
  • 3 leather for 3 books

With this, you learn how to harvest trees, grow sugar cane and breed cows, all essential for survival. You also get your equipment more powerful than ever.

3. Traverse Minecraft’s Worlds

If you want to know how to get good at Minecraft, you need to learn how to traverse the other “worlds” in it. There are three worlds in total in Minecraft Java Edition, with different ones in the Mobile Version. They are:

  • The Overworld
  • The Nether
  • The End

The Overworld is the world where you are. The Nether is a hell-like landscape full of lava and hostile enemies. The End is a dark void that houses the Ender Dragon.

To access the Nether, you need to create a Nether Portal, a rectangular frame made of obsidian with at least a 4×5 block size.

The End is much more complicated to access, needing an Eye of Ender to point you towards an End Portal.

4. Getting to the End

Speaking of The End, going to a Stronghold using an Eye of Ender is essential. It’s a great way to get better resources and end-game content.

Minecraft experts use the End for many purposes. This includes killing the Ender Dragon for XP and Dragon’s Breath. There’s also accessing End Cities and End Ships.

To get to the End, craft an Eye of Ender using Ender Pearls from Enderman and Blaze Powder. Blaze Powder is craftable from Blaze Rods, which a Nether monster called Blaze drops.

It’s best to have a few of these as a Stronghold may be thousands of blocks away. Throw them in the air and follow the general direction where the orb goes. Once an Eye of Ender stops, you can start digging down and find the Stronghold.

Every Stronghold will have a room that contains the End portal, with a random number Eyes of Ender added.

5. Advanced Combat: Shields and Blocking

Want to know how to be good at Minecraft?

In earlier versions of Minecraft, blocking was not an integral part of combat. Now, a shield can protect you from both projectiles and melee weapons. It’s cheap as well.

All you need for a shield is a piece of iron surrounded by 6 planks in a Y-formation. With this, you can protect yourself from annoying enemies. This includes the likes of Skeletons and powerful enemies like the Enderman.

6. Test Redstone Circuits in Creative

Many Minecraft experts are great at Redstone, creating automated systems and circuits as well. Even then, doing Redstone circuits in Survival can be a hassle. There’s an easy way to do this.

If you are going to practice Redstone, practice on Creative. This saves you the unneeded resource gathering, together with unlimited tries without worrying about resource wastage. Once you finish on Creative, you’ll have enough experience to replicate it in Survival.

7. Keep Exploring The Overworld

Are you looking for rare items? One of the best Minecraft pro tips you can use is to explore, explore and explore. Rare locales will have special generated structures. These include:

  • Desert Pyramids
  • Jungle Temples
  • Water Temples
  • Mineshafts
  • Underwater Ruins

Within these structures, there is an added level of danger. Cave spiders, explosive traps and even Elder Guardians. You need to have enough equipment to take care of the danger.
